termite in Chinese is 白蚁 — termite means a pale, soft-bodied wood-eating insect that lives in large colonies.
termite in Chinese
白蚁
Pronounced: bái yǐ
A white-bodied, wood-consuming insect of the infraorder Isoptera, in the order Blattodea.
What does "termite" mean?
-
noun A pale, soft-bodied wood-eating insect that lives in large colonies.
"Termites had eaten through the wooden support beams."
